Scholastic Corporation (NASDAQ: SCHL) is the world's largest publisher and distributor of children's books, a leading provider of core literacy curriculum and professional services, and a producer of educational and entertaining children's media. The Company creates quality books and ebooks, print and technology-based learning programs for pre-K to grade 12, classroom magazines and other products and services that support children's learning both in school and at home. With operations in 14 international offices and exports to 165 countries, Scholastic makes quality, affordable books available to all children around the world through school-based book clubs and book fairs, classroom collections, school and public libraries, retail and online. True to its mission of more than 100 years to encourage the personal and intellectual growth of all children beginning with literacy, the Company has earned a reputation as a trusted partner to educators and families. THE OPPORTUNITY


Scholastic Education Solutions Division is seeking to hire an energetic part-time Literacy Specialist (per diem) with deep knowledge of systematic and explicit instruction in foundational reading skills, and experience implementing structured literacy instruction. The primary role of the Literacy Specialist is to deliver literacy-based professional learning and reflective coaching to support district partners across the region.  This role involves both virtual and in-person facilitation, product training, and coaching to ensure comprehensive support and engagement with our partners.


RESPONSIBILITIES

  • Facilitate professional learning using adult learning methodologies to support structured literacy practices and product implementation.
  • Deliver professional learning, coach classroom teachers and instructional coaches on structured literacy practices and foundational reading skills.
  • Support classroom teachers and school leaders in building content knowledge and understanding their role in the implementation process.
  • Provide feedback as part of the coaching cycle to pinpoint progress areas and development opportunities.
  • Maintain highest degree of expertise in literacy instruction and Scholastic product knowledge.
  • Maintain professional relationships with districts.
  • Cultivate and maintain collaborative relationships with the team and partners.

Qualifications

HOW YOU CAN FIT


  • Master's Degree (or progress toward a degree) in education or a reading-related field.
  • Minimum of 3-5 years of experience facilitating face-to-face professional learning in literacy and/or reading.
  • At least 3-5 years of teaching or instructional coaching experience.
  • Deep knowledge of systematic and explicit instruction in foundational reading skills and experience implementing structured literacy instruction.
  • In-depth understanding of language acquisition theories and the ability to apply these principles to instructional strategies.
  • Proficiency in implementing linguistically and culturally responsive teaching methodologies.
  • Experience teaching Multi-Lingual Learners or bilingual proficiency is a plus.
  • Current knowledge of college and career readiness standards.
  • Understanding of the human change process and adult learning theories.
  • Ability to maintain a flexible travel schedule.
  • Working knowledge of Microsoft Office and PowerPoint.
  • Experience using virtual presentation platforms such as Zoom and Teams.
  • Excellent interpersonal, oral, and written communication skills.
  • Strong facilitation skills, professionalism, and creativity.
  • Valid driver’s license.
